VENTILATION APPARATUS AND VENTILATION SYSTEM INCLUDING THE SAME

A ventilation apparatus including a housing having an inlet flow path to discharge outdoor air, to an indoor space through a first outlet, and an outlet flow path to discharge indoor air, to an outdoor space through a second outlet, a total enthalpy heat exchanger in which air flowing along the inlet flow path and air flowing along the outlet flow path exchange heat, and a heat exchanger to remove moisture in the air flowing along the inlet flow path. The housing including a connection flow path connecting the inlet flow path to the outlet flow path, and a connection path opening and closing unit configured to selectively open and close the connection flow path. The connection flow path to allow indoor air, to pass through the heat exchanger and flow to the first outlet while preventing the indoor air from flowing to the total enthalpy heat exchanger.

INDOOR AIR POLLUTION PREVENTION SYSTEM

An indoor pollution prevention system includes a plurality of gas detection modules, one or more intelligent control-driving processing devices, one or more gas-exchange processing devices, one or more intake passages, and one or more discharge passages. The intake passage is connected to the gas-exchange processing device and has an intake opening for guiding the outdoor gas into an indoor space. The discharge passage is connected to the gas-exchange processing device and has a discharge opening for discharging the air pollution source to the outdoor space. The intelligent control-driving processing device controls the gas-exchange processing device to be enabled under a surveillance condition of the gas detection module, so that the air pollution source passes through the discharge passage, filtered and purified by a cleaning and filtration assembly, and is discharged to the outdoor space, thereby allowing the indoor space to have a clean air.

VENTILATION DEVICE

A device for treating the air in a confined space has a first module and a second module that are telescopically coupled, in such a way that the two modules can slide one respect to the other in order to adjust to a different thickness of a wall that separates the inside from the outside. The device has a heat exchanger disposed in the first module, a first fan disposed in the first module downstream a filter to extract air from the outside to the inside, and a second fan disposed in the second module to extract air from the inside to the outside. The device also has a radon detector connected to a control unit that controls the two fans.

Ventilation system and heat exchange-type ventilation device

The range hood unit includes a range hood transmitting unit configured to transmit information on an exhaust volume. The heat exchanging ventilation device (1) includes: a heat exchanger receiving unit (19) configured to receive the information from the range hood transmitting unit; and a heat exchanger control unit (17) configured to determine the operation of the heat exchanging ventilation device (1), based on the information received by the heat exchanger receiving unit (19). Based on the exhaust volume of the range hood unit that has been received by the heat exchanger receiving unit (19), the ventilation system exhausts air by subtracting the exhaust volume of the range hood unit from an exhaust volume equivalent to the air supply volume of the heat exchanging ventilation device (1).

GREENHOUSE-LINKED AIR CONDITIONING SYSTEM AND AIR CONDITIONING METHOD USING THE SAME

A greenhouse-linked air conditioning system includes a first greenhouse through which sunlight is transmitted and in which plants are grown, a second greenhouse through which sunlight is not transmitted and in which plants are grown, an indoor space excluding the first and second greenhouses in a building, a sunlight panel formed outside the first greenhouse and generating power using the sunlight, an auxiliary light source connected to the sunlight panel to provide light to the second greenhouse, and an air conditioning unit configured to connect the first and second greenhouses and the indoor space and selectively exchange air, humidity, and energy between the first and second greenhouses and the indoor space.

SOUNDPROOF ENCLOSURE

A method for building a soundproof enclosure (10) in the form of an independent structure with acoustic properties for isolating noise and vibration is disclosed. The soundproof enclosure (10) comprised a plurality of acoustical wall panels (12) interconnectable each to another at opposing sides for enclosing an interior space (41) of various sizes. The soundproof enclosure (10) further comprised one or more modular multilayer ceiling unit(s) (13) assembled onto the top edges of the acoustical wall panels (12) to form the enclosure. The ceiling unit (13) comprised a plurality of ceiling layers (17), each ceiling layer (17) being vertically spaced apart with one another by brackets to topographically form the multiple guided spaces necessary for air flow circulation within the enclosure (10). These guided spaces can also house multiple implements such as circulation fan, air filter and sound silencer. Sound insulating material layer(s) are interposed between the contacting surfaces of the ceiling unit (13) and the acoustical wall panels (12) and/or all around the surfaces to isolate and decouple the ceiling unit (13) from the acoustical wall panels (12) from vibrations. A sound barrier cover (16a or 79) is interposed at the openings (25) of the air passages (24) to further reduce the sound level emitted into and exiting from the enclosure. In addition, a construction method by elevating the heavy acoustical wall panels (12) and the ceiling units (13) until they fall into precise assembly location for ease of assembly of the components of the enclosure (10) and a floor base unit 11 that enabled the enclosure (10) to about easily in whole is also disclosed. Furthermore, a method to ease assembly of the enclosure (10) by use of removable heavy-duty handles (87) is disclosed.
